/**
 
 * Defines all constants for qualifying MySQL User table.
 
 * The framework built-in class User uses these information.
 
 */
 
 
/**
 
 *  Constant representing the User MySQL Table name
 
 */
 
define("USER_TABLE","user");
 
 
/**
 
 *  Constant representing the (mandatory integer) primary key field
 
 *  used to identify a user
 
 */
 
define("USER_ID","id_user");
 
 
/**
 
 *  Defines a constant representing (mandatory unique) EMAIL field name.
 
 *  Note: Email is required as user Login name
 
 */
 
define("USER_EMAIL","email");
 
 
/**
 
 *  Defines a constant representing the PASSWORD field name.
 
 *  Note: password is used during login process
 
 */
 
define("USER_PASSWORD","password");
 
 
/**
 
 *  Defines a constant representing the (mandatory integer) ROLE field used
 
 *  for grouping users that must have the same access level rights
 
 *  on controllers.
 
 *  Note: The framework R.B.A.C. (Role Based Access Control) Engine can
 
 *  grant access to one ore more roles on controllers execution
 
 *
 
 */
 
define('USER_ROLE', 'id_access_level');
 
 
/**
 
 *  Defines a constant representing the SALT field.
 
 *  Salt is used for user password encryption. Leave it blank If you
 
 *  don't like to use it and using a system default one.
 
 */
 
define('USER_SALT', 'salt');
 
 
/**
 
 *  Defines a constant representing  the (mandatory integer) USER_ENABLED
 
 *  field used as flag for enabling/disabling user.
 
 *  Only enabled users are able to authenticate and login on the system.
 
 *  If you don't like to manage this capabilities leave blank this value.
 
 *  The value that this field can assume are only:
 
 *     1 (for enabling a user to authentication)
 
 *     or
 
 *    -1 (for temporary disabling user).
 
 */
 
define('USER_ENABLED', 'enabled');
 
 
/**
 
 *  Defines a constant representing  the USER token
 
 *  field
 
 */
 
define('USER_TOKEN', 'token');
 
 
/**
 
 *  Defines a constant representing  the USER token timestamp
 
 *  field used to manage token expiration
 
 */
 
define('USER_TOKEN_TS', 'token_timestamp');
 
 
/**
 
 *  Defines a constant representing  the last_login
 
 *  field used to store last user log in
 
 */
 
define('USER_LAST_LOGIN', 'last_login');
 
 
/**
 
 *  Defines a constant for identifying administrators role vale
 
 *  Note: Framework need to known the value you want use for identifying
 
 *  administrators role. So it can automatically assign
 
 *  administration rights
 
 */
 
define('ADMIN_ROLE_ID', 100);

/**
 
 * Securing PHP session and cookies
 
 */
 
// session.entropy_file = "/dev/urandom" (better entropy source)
 
ini_set('session.use_strict_mode', 1);
 
ini_set('session.use_cookies', 1);
 
ini_set('session.use_only_cookies', 1);
 
ini_set('session.cookie_httponly', 1);
 
ini_set('session.cookie_lifetime ', 0);
 
ini_set('session.cookie_secure', isset($_SERVER["HTTPS"]));
 
ini_set('session.name','WEBMVCFramework');

/**
 
 * Securing file access.
 
 * Specifies a path, outside HTTP access, where framework and application classes
 
 * could be located. In this way, you can protect directory access from HTTP.
 
 * Note: if it's value is null all framework files and classes must be located
 
 * inside the same application directory (anythings is potentially accessible from HTTP).
 
 *
 
 * Setting example:
 
 *
 
 *    define ("SECURING_OUTSIDE_HTTP_FOLDER","C:/Wamp/Apache2.2/mvcout_framework/");
 
 *
 
 * If you set SECURING_OUTSIDE_HTTP_FOLDER you also must set RELATIVE_PATH inside
 
 * index.php
 
 *
 
 * For example:
 
 *
 
 *    define ("RELATIVE_PATH", "C:/Wamp/Apache2.2/mvcout_framework/");
 
 *
 
 *
 
 *
 
 * WARNING: When using SECURING_OUTSIDE_HTTP_FOLDER you must to separate files and
 
 * directors in this way;
 
 *
 
 * PATH NOT ACCESSIBLE FROM HTTP                PATH ACCESSIBLE FROM HTTP
 
 * =============================                =========================
 
 * classes                                      css
 
 * config                                       js
 
 * framework                                    framework/js
 
 * controllers                                  util (only if you want to run builders)
 
 * models                                       temp (a temporary folder)
 
 * views                                        index.php
 
 * templates                                    .htaccess
 
 * locales
 
 *
 
 */
 
define ("SECURING_OUTSIDE_HTTP_FOLDER","");
